A user can provide a MDP file with the -x option. Yet, that MDP file
cannot overwrite options that are defined in the default MDP template.
Indeed, the option would the appear twice in the resulting MDP file,
which would cause Gromacs to crash.

This commit introduces option deduplication for MDP files. When an
option is defined several time, only the last definition is kept. Note
that the deduplication does not conserve the order, the comments, not
the empty lines.
